Painlevé scheme
Abstract
In this note, we review the notion of Painlevé scheme of the sixth Painlevé equation from the viewpoint of accessible singular point and its local index in the Hirzebruch surface of degree two ${Σ_2}$. The key method is Painlevé $α$-method for each accessible singular point. Giving a Painlevé scheme in the differential system satisfying certain conditions, we can recover the Painlevé VI system with the polynomial Hamiltonian. We also consider the case of the Painlevé V,IV and III systems, respectively. Finally, we study non-linear ordinary differential systems in dimension two with only simple accessible singular $(n+2)$-points in the Hirzebruch surface of degree $n$; ${Σ_n}$. This equation has symmetry of symmetric group of degree $n+2$.
